Each electrical box has a maximum fill capacity determined by the number and size of conductors, devices, clamps, and ground wires. The NEC provides volume allowances in cubic inches for each conductor size. For example, 12 AWG conductors require 2.25 cubic inches per conductor. Ground wires collectively count as a single conductor, and device yokes or internal clamps add additional allowances. The total volume of all components must not exceed the box's rated capacity to prevent overheating and insulation damage ( ).
Electrical boxes can be metallic or nonmetallic. Metal boxes are typically used with metal raceways, armored cables, or where mechanical strength is required, and must be grounded and bonded to maintain electrical continuity. Nonmetallic boxes are common in residential or dry locations but must be listed for use with any metallic raceways or fittings they connect to. Boxes for wet or corrosive environments require weatherproof or specially coated enclosures ( ).
Boxes must be securely fastened to the structure and remain rigid to prevent physical damage. They should be flush with finished surfaces to allow proper cover installation and minimize fire spread. Openings around boxes in noncombustible surfaces must not exceed ¼ inch. Boxes must also provide sufficient depth and internal space to accommodate wiring without damaging conductors ( ).
NEC mandates that all junction boxes remain accessible for inspection and maintenance. Properly executed splices and wire connections must be protected from mechanical stress and environmental damage. Overfilling a box or using improper fasteners can create fire hazards or code violations ( ).
Boxes installed in damp or wet locations—such as basements, barns, or areas in contact with the ground—must be rated for such conditions. Interior damp locations include areas with concrete slabs or unprotected exposure to moisture ( ).
